Ski Area Tux
With the "Zillertaler Superskipass", you have access to 650 kilometres of piste and 8 ski areas in the Ziller, Gerlos and Tux valleys, which are excellently connected by a free shuttle bus (see ski region). The ski and glacier world Zillertal 3000 combines the ski areas around Ahorn, Penken, Rastkogel, Eggalm and the Hintertux Glacier - an areal with 245 kilometres and 65 lifts between 630 - 3,250 m. The Hintertux Glacier is even especially snow-sure in summer and offers varied runs. Whether you take on the long run from the Gefrorene Wand (frozen wall), test the buckle pistes at Olperer or prefer to enjoy the deep snow area at Kaserer, there is no lack of options! A further highlight is the "Gletscherrunde", where you can conquer 15,000 meters in altitude and 72 km of runs. The pistes at Eggalm offer a beautiful view of the Tux Valley and the Penken and Horberg ski area is also reachable over the Rastkogel. In addition to the legendary Harakiri piste, you will also find the first-rate "Vans Penken Funpark". Without direct connection to Tux, only reachable over Mayrhofen, a small but fine beginner's area with Austria's largest pendulum cableway awaits you at Ahorn.
